Profile: Fifi Mahony's is a Retail stores, not elsewhere classified company located at New Orleans, Louisiana USA, address is 934 Royal St, New Orleans 70116-2702 LA, postcode is 70116-2702, you can contact Fifi Mahony's by phone 5045254343
Please share as much information as you can about Fifi Mahony's so other users can benefit from your comment.